CLEAR THE THROAT

Pronunciation (US): Play  (GB): Play

 I. (verb) 

Sense 1

Meaning:

Clear mucus or food from one's throatplay

Example:

he cleared his throat before he started to speak

Synonyms:

clear the throat; hawk

Classified under:

Verbs of grooming, dressing and bodily care

Hypernyms (to "clear the throat" is one way to...):

cough (exhale abruptly, as when one has a chest cold or congestion)

Sentence frame:

Somebody ----s
